>> Hi all,
>>
>> This series fixes support for loading kernel to XKPHYS space.
>> It is derived from "MIPS: use virtual addresses from xkphys for MIPS64" [1].
>>
>> Boot tested on boston and QEMU with loading address set to 0xa800000090000000.
>> QEMU patch on the way.
>>
>> Gregory and Vladimir, do let me know if I missed anything.
>
> Thanks for this series, I reviewed it and tested it on my platform, so
> you can add for all the patches:
>
> Reviewed-by: Gregory CLEMENT <gregory.clement@bootlin.com>
> Tested-by: Gregory CLEMENT <gregory.clement@bootlin.com>
>
> However I add to fix the patch " MIPS: Handle mips_cps_core_entry within
> lower 4G", I think you missed a case. I will comment on it.
I found a better solution for CPS handling, will send v2 later together with
fixes to bring TO_CAC to 32bit.
Thanks.
